About Thomas Sporer

Thomas Sporer is a scholar working on Signal Processing,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Cognitive Neuroscience, Computer Science Applications and Speech and Hearing, having authored 56 papers that have together received 708 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Speech and Audio Processing (12 papers), Hearing Loss and Rehabilitation (11 papers), Advanced Data Compression Techniques (10 papers), Digital Filter Design and Implementation (9 papers), Image and Signal Denoising Methods (8 papers), Education Methods and Technologies (8 papers), Acoustic Wave Phenomena Research (7 papers) and Music Technology and Sound Studies (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(513 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(365 cit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(187 citations), Computational Mechanics (152 citations) and Speech and Hearing (34 citations). Thomas Sporer has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Austria. Frequent co-authors include Karlheinz Brandenburg, John G. Beerends, Catherine Colomes, William C. Treurniet, Roland Bitto, Christian Schmidmer, Christian Uhle, Christian Dittmar, Ralf Geiger and Eric Allamanche.
